Othello Act Three Flashcards
Iago’s scheming?
Iago continues to manipulate Othello, planting more doubts about Desdemona’s fidelity.
He insinuates that Desdemona’s closeness to Cassio is suspicious and subtly suggests that she might be having an affair with him.
Othello’s reaction?
Othello becomes consumed with jealousy and increasingly distrustful of Desdemona. He treats her progressively coldly and loses much respect from her in this act. He begins to distance himself with her.
Desdemona’s thoughts?
Desdemona is unaware of the growing tension and she continues to plead Cassio’s case to Othello. This simply furthers Othello’s doubts and distrust upon her insistence.
Meanwhile - Iago?
Iago continues to manipulate others, getting Emilia (his wife and Desdemona’s maid) to steal Desdemona’s handkerchief, which he later uses as evidence of her infidelity. He plants the handkerchief in Cassio’s chambers for him to find with confusion.
Othello?
Othello becomes increasingly erratic and begins to show signs of deep jealousy and suspicion.
